Brett Ashby: The Artistic Maverick Blending Creativity and Motion

Within contemporary art, artists are constantly pushing the boundaries of creativity, seeking new and exciting ways to express their unique visions. One of those artists is Brett Ashby, and his journey has been very interesting to follow. From a tender age, Brett’s innate creativity found expression through paint, with his very first framed piece exhibited proudly in his Primary School Principal’s office during Class 1. This early glimpse of his talent hinted at a future filled with artistic innovation.

But it was in 2009, when he traveled to America, that his artistic landscape shifted in the direction of fine art. Notably, he ventured into the world of portraiture, capturing the likeness of iconic figures such as Barack Obama. Brett’s work placed him in esteemed company alongside names like American artist and activist Shepard Fairey, Ron English, and the elusive street artist Banksy.

In 2014, Brett introduced an innovative concept that would further solidify his reputation as a boundary-pushing artist. During the Sculpture by the Sea event in Bondi Beach, Sydney, Australia, he showcased a groundbreaking performance art piece known as “Skate and Paint.” This innovative performance involved Brett simultaneously skateboarding and painting on a panel van vehicle, which happened to be his car at the time. The fusion of art and motion transformed the vehicle into a mobile sculpture, capturing the imaginations of art enthusiasts and adrenaline junkies alike.

The seed for this unique idea was planted during Brett’s time in London, where he collaborated with artist and curator Christine Perera. Both were intrigued by the concept of movement and the act of rolling, which ultimately paved the way for the “Skate and Paint” concept. This bold move was a perfect representation of Brett’s adventurous spirit and his constant quest for novel artistic experiences.

Brett’s portfolio includes a wide array of completed series, such as “Energy,” “Frequency,” “Ripples Of Love,” “Inner Essence,” and his latest endeavor, “Sonic Flight.” Each series is a testament to his ability to explore new themes and ideas, making each creation a unique and captivating piece of art.

One of the defining moments in Brett’s career was his first official commission for this innovative approach to art. Art Town, a local event in his hometown of Melbourne, recognized his remarkable talent and commissioned him to transform a section of a fence into a wall artwork for the opening of John Olsen’s new Art Series Hotel on Chapel Street.

Brett used aerosol cans to adorn the fence palings with vibrant, colorful aura lines while rolling back and forth on the iconic Prahran vert ramp on his skateboard. This visually stunning work not only earned the accolade of “best in show” but was also personally collected by Mr. Olsen, the patron of the event. It was a momentous occasion, marking Brett’s place in the art world.

The heart of his work is his performance action painting, which he describes as a spiritual process. It’s about striking the brush when encountering that moment of metamorphosis, much like a pendulum while skateboarding. These works are not just about aesthetics; they harmonize the mind, body, and soul to activate the inner creative in all, promoting a sense of oneness with the artistic process.
